Core Mechanisms: How It Works

At its core, mirroring a Mac to a TV involves two primary processes: video encoding and transmission. Your Mac encodes the screen as a video stream (using H.264, HEVC, or AV1 codecs), then sends it to the TV via Wi-Fi (for AirPlay), Ethernet (for wired solutions), or a physical cable (HDMI). The TV decodes this stream and displays it. The bottleneck? Your Mac’s GPU and CPU must handle the encoding load, while your network must provide sufficient bandwidth—especially for 4K or high-refresh-rate content.

Latency is the silent killer of smooth mirroring. AirPlay 2 introduces a ~50ms delay by default, which is negligible for movies but disastrous for gaming or live editing. Wired solutions like HDMI adapters cut this to near-instantaneous, but they require physical connections. Third-party apps often add their own layers of compression, which can degrade quality or introduce lag. The key is balancing convenience with performance—knowing when to sacrifice wireless freedom for lower latency or higher resolution.

Comparative Analysis

Method Pros and Cons
AirPlay 2
  • Pros: Wireless, easy setup, supports multiple devices, works with HomeKit.
  • Cons: Limited to Apple TV or AirPlay-compatible TVs, ~50ms latency, bandwidth-heavy for 4K.
HDMI Adapter (USB-C/Thunderbolt)
  • Pros: Plug-and-play, no latency, supports 4K/60Hz, works with any TV.
  • Cons: Requires physical connection, no wireless flexibility, may need additional power adapter.
Third-Party Apps (Reflector, LonelyScreen)
  • Pros: Works with non-Apple TVs, customizable settings, some support multi-monitor setups.
  • Cons: Subscription costs, potential latency, requires additional software.
Chromecast or Fire Stick
  • Pros: Affordable, works with non-Apple devices, supports casting from Chrome.
  • Cons: Higher latency, limited macOS integration, lower resolution support.

Comprehensive FAQs

Q: Why isn’t AirPlay showing up as an option on my TV?

A: AirPlay requires either an Apple TV (4K or newer) or a TV with built-in AirPlay 2 support (like many Sony, Samsung, or LG models). If your TV isn’t listed, check for firmware updates or consider a third-party app like Reflector. Also, ensure your Mac and TV are on the same Wi-Fi network and that AirPlay is enabled in System Settings > Displays > AirPlay Display.

Q: Can I mirror my Mac to a TV without an Apple TV?

A: Yes, but your options depend on the TV. For non-Apple TVs, use third-party apps like Reflector (paid) or LonelyScreen (free trial), or connect via HDMI adapter. Some newer TVs (like Samsung’s with Tizen OS) support AirPlay natively. If all else fails, a Chromecast or Fire Stick can cast Chrome tabs, though with higher latency.

Q: How do I reduce lag when mirroring my Mac to TV?

A: For AirPlay, ensure your Wi-Fi is 5GHz and your router supports MU-MIMO. Use an Ethernet connection for wired solutions, or opt for an HDMI adapter (like the USB-C to HDMI dongle) for near-zero latency. If using third-party apps, lower the resolution or bitrate in their settings. For gaming, enable Low Latency Mode in macOS if available.

Q: Will mirroring affect my Mac’s performance?

A: Yes, especially with wireless methods. Mirroring requires your Mac to encode the screen in real-time, which can tax the CPU/GPU. For heavy workloads (like video editing), use a wired HDMI connection or close unnecessary apps. If performance drops, try reducing the mirroring resolution in System Settings > Displays > Mirroring Options.

Q: Can I mirror my Mac to a TV in 4K?

A: It depends on your Mac, TV, and connection. M1/M2 Macs with ProRes or Dolby Vision support can mirror 4K to compatible TVs via AirPlay 2 (if the network and TV support it). For HDMI, use a USB-C to HDMI 2.1 adapter (like the CalDigit TS4) for 4K/60Hz. Non-Mac models may be limited to 1080p or 4K at lower refresh rates.

Q: Why does my mirrored screen look pixelated or blurry?

A: This usually happens due to resolution mismatches. Ensure your Mac and TV are set to the same resolution (e.g., 1920x1080). For AirPlay, check if your TV supports the resolution you’re trying to mirror. If using an HDMI adapter, verify it supports the desired resolution (e.g., HDMI 2.0 for 4K/60Hz). Lowering the mirroring resolution in macOS settings may also help.

Q: Can I use an old HDMI adapter to mirror my MacBook Pro to a TV?

A: It depends on the adapter and your Mac. Older MacBook Pros (pre-2016) used Mini DisplayPort, requiring a Mini DP to HDMI adapter. Newer models (2016+) use USB-C, needing a USB-C to HDMI adapter. Avoid cheap adapters—they may not support 4K or could lack power delivery, requiring a separate power source. For best results, use an official Apple or certified third-party adapter.

Q: How do I mirror audio along with video?

A: For AirPlay, audio should mirror automatically if your TV is set as the output device. For HDMI adapters, ensure the adapter supports audio passthrough (most do). In macOS, go to System Settings > Sound > Output and select your TV as the device. If using third-party apps, check their audio settings for separate volume controls.
